Approaches for reducing the risk of invasive species introductions through tourist and recreationist pathways in reserves.
This evergreen article examines practical strategies to minimize invasive species introductions driven by visitors, hikers, campers, anglers, and other recreationists within protected reserves, emphasizing prevention, detection, and rapid response.

In many reserves, the arrival of non-native species follows familiar routes: hiking boots carried seeds from trails, gear harboring pests, and even travelers unintentionally transporting organisms in soil and water. The effectiveness of prevention rests on understanding human movement patterns and the points where contact with ecosystems is most likely. Managers can map popular access points, encampment zones, and water crossings to identify critical contact surfaces. By coupling this analysis with targeted outreach, agencies can tailor messages that resonate with diverse user groups. Designing interventions that fit real-world behaviors increases compliance. Importantly, prevention must be ongoing, not a one-off campaign, and should adapt as visitation trends shift.
Education is foundational but must be paired with feasible management measures. Communities accustomed to outdoor recreation respond best when safety and enjoyment are preserved. Signage should be clear, multilingual where applicable, and strategically placed at trailheads, boat ramps, and parking areas. Tools like boot cleaning stations, boot brush mats, and accessible handwashing stations reduce the chance of bringing hitchhiking organisms into sensitive zones. Rangers should conduct routine inspections of gear in high-traffic seasons and provide short demonstrations on how to sanitize equipment. Digital campaigns, including short videos and interactive maps, can reinforce messages beyond the immediate site visit, extending reach to potential visitors before they depart home.
Continuous engagement helps communities own prevention responsibilities.
A practical framework combines prevention, detection, and rapid response to keep invasive species from establishing populations. Prevention focuses on reducing propagule pressure at access points, with dedicated cleaning stations and gear restrictions in place. Detection relies on trained volunteers, citizen scientists, and routine surveys that search for early-warning indicators like unusual plant growth, animal sightings, or soil disturbances. Rapid response plans outline who acts, how to mobilize resources, and the steps to contain a detection. This triad helps reserves act decisively, minimizing ecological and economic damage. Clear roles and rehearsed drills ensure readiness when an intrusion is found, preventing delay and confusion that can worsen outcomes.

The success of detection programs hinges on community involvement and practical incentives. Volunteer networks can perform regular patrols, document observations, and report anomalies through simple reporting apps. Local schools, clubs, and outdoor groups can participate as citizen monitors, creating a broader safety net. Incentives for participation might include recognition, access to exclusive events, or small equipment stipends. Social norms also matter; when visitors notice others cleaning boots and using designated gear, they are more likely to follow suit. Collaboration with neighboring jurisdictions expands the geographic reach of surveillance, sharing data and coordinating responses across landscapes that share similar species and pathways.
Partnerships expand capacity and align values across stakeholders.
Pathway management begins with the design of access facilities that minimize contact with soil and vegetation. Boardwalks, hard-packed trails, and watercraft wash stations reduce opportunities for seeds or small organisms to cling to clothing or equipment. When feasible, reseal or replace porous surfaces that trap debris. This physical engineering approach should be paired with seasonal closures of select zones during high-risk periods, allowing ecosystems to breathe while still offering recreational access. Any changes should be explained in plain language to visitors to foster understanding and cooperation. Transparent rationale is essential to maintaining trust and compliance among diverse user groups.

Monitoring and surveillance technologies can enhance early detection without imposing heavy burdens on visitors. Environmental DNA sampling, camera traps, and portable soil sensors enable managers to notice hidden incursions before they become visible in the field. Data dashboards provide real-time insights into risk hot spots, guiding targeted interventions. Importantly, technology should support staff and volunteers rather than overwhelm them. User-friendly interfaces, clear alerts, and digestible reports help field personnel interpret signals quickly and act. Investments in training ensure that all partners can interpret results and understand when to escalate actions.
Tools and policies support consistent, accountable practice.
Visitor behavior influences both risk and prevention outcomes. Encouraging certain practices—such as inspecting gear before departure, keeping pets leashed, and using designated waste disposal areas—reduces potential transport of invasive organisms. Creating memorable, positive experiences around compliance can shift norms over time. For instance, reward-based programs that celebrate clean gear or successful cleanings at the entrance can turn routines into habits. Clear consequences for noncompliance, coupled with fair enforcement, reinforce the seriousness of prevention while preserving a welcoming atmosphere for recreation. Balancing enforcement with education is key to enduring success.
Reserves can tailor messaging to different audiences, including weekend hikers, long-distance trekkers, anglers, boaters, and campers. Demographic considerations—language, accessibility, and cultural relevance—improve message effectiveness. Partnerships with guides, outfitters, and concessionaires ensure consistent standards across experiences. Co-created codes of conduct, signage, and checklists foster a shared sense of responsibility. By aligning recreational values with stewardship, managers transform visitors into allies who help safeguard the reserve’s native species and ecosystem functions.

Shared responsibility builds resilience against introductions.
Cleaning protocols at entry points should be simple, standardized, and time-efficient to minimize friction. A quick demonstration by staff or volunteers can set a positive example, illustrating how to remove debris and dry equipment properly. When visitors understand the rationale and see others participating, compliance rises. Physical infrastructure—wash stations, boot brushes, and accessible drying areas—reduces barriers to proper cleaning. Policies requiring certain checks for high-risk activities, such as boating or camping in sensitive zones, provide a predictable framework for managers and visitors alike.
Spatial planning can limit invasive introductions by separating high-risk travel modes from vulnerable habitats. Zoning strategies can restrict certain activities to lower-risk corridors, while still preserving access to other areas for recreation. Seasonal buffers create windows during which sensitive ecosystems recover after peak visitation. Restoring native vegetation along trails reduces the likelihood that invaders take hold in disturbed soils. Logging and mapping of risk areas support adaptive management, enabling managers to reallocate resources quickly where new threats emerge.
Early-warning systems that engage local communities create a broader vigilance network. Regular outreach events, citizen science projects, and open data platforms invite public participation in monitoring efforts. Transparent reporting processes encourage timely notification of unusual sightings, enabling swift verification and response. When residents feel connected to park health, they become trusted guardians who contribute to long-term resilience. A culture of shared responsibility ensures that prevention is not dependent on a small workforce but embedded in everyday recreation. Sustained funding and political support are necessary to maintain momentum over time.
Finally, continuous evaluation strengthens the entire approach. Managers should measure how many introductions were prevented, how quickly detections occurred, and what social factors influenced compliance. Periodic audits of gear-cleaning stations, signage clarity, and adherence to access rules reveal gaps and opportunities. Feedback loops from visitors, volunteers, and staff help refine programs to better fit evolving recreational trends. By iterating on prevention, detection, and response, reserves can maintain robust defenses against invasive species without sacrificing the enjoyment that draws people to natural areas. Regular reviews keep strategies fresh, evidence-based, and resilient to emerging threats.
